Search

CN-116455971-B - System and method for realizing bidirectional communication of digital twin multi-path read-write equipment data

CN116455971BCN 116455971 BCN116455971 BCN 116455971BCN-116455971-B

Abstract

The invention discloses a system and a method for realizing data bidirectional communication of digital twin multi-path read-write equipment, wherein the system comprises a front-end data receiving module, a front-end data unified processing module, a front-end message event interaction module, a front-end data distribution module, a background data receiving module, a background data unified processing module, a background message event interaction module and a background data distribution module, wherein the front-end data receiving module and the background data receiving module are used for receiving processing data at the same time, the modules can process the processing data directly, the processing data can not be processed by the modules, the processing data can be distributed after being processed by other processing modules, and the front-end and the background cooperate to receive the processing distribution data together.

Inventors

  • WU KEBING
  • WU KEWEI
  • HE JINJIN
  • GAO HAORAN
  • AN JIN
  • Hao Wangdong

Assignees

  • 武汉乐吾乐科技有限责任公司

Dates

Publication Date
20260508
Application Date
20230414

Claims (10)

  1. 1. The system for realizing data bidirectional communication by the digital twin multi-path read-write equipment is characterized by comprising a front-end data receiving module, a front-end data unified processing module, a front-end message event interaction module, a front-end data distribution module, a background data receiving module, a background data unified processing module, a background message event interaction module and a background data distribution module, wherein the front-end data receiving module is used for receiving data of various equipment and data sent by the background data distribution module, and carrying out identity authentication, screening and noise data and format judgment on the data received by the front end; The front-end data unified processing module is used for carrying out unified conversion on data formats which are not in the standard format in the data received by the front end, converting the data into the data in the standard format and sending the data in the standard format to the front-end message event interaction module; the front-end message event interaction module is used for receiving data in a standard format, updating a message event, informing a corresponding module to process the message event, judging whether the message event meets the trigger event condition to obtain a judging result, and executing corresponding operation according to the judging result; the front-end data distribution module sends out the data of which the front end meets the triggering event; the background data receiving module is used for receiving the data of the diversified devices and the data sent by the front-end data distribution module, and carrying out identity authentication, screening and noise filtering data and format judgment on the data received by the background; the background data unified processing module is used for carrying out unified conversion on data which is not in a standard format in the data received by the background, converting the data into the data in the standard format and sending the data in the standard format to the background message event interaction module; The background message event interaction module is used for receiving data in a standard format, updating a message event, informing a corresponding module to process the message event, judging whether the message event meets the trigger event condition to obtain a judging result, and executing corresponding operation according to the judging result; the background data distribution module is used for sending out data of which the background meets the triggering event condition; The front-end data receiving module and the background data receiving module simultaneously receive processing data sent by the diversity equipment, the front-end module and the background module can process the processing data directly, the data which cannot be processed is processed by other recognition modules and then distributed, the diversity equipment data can be directly communicated with the front-end visualization, and the diversity equipment data is changed into internal data after being processed by the background data and then distributed to other back-end modules or the front-end module.
  2. 2. The system of claim 1, wherein the front-end data receiving module includes a front-end identity authentication unit, the front-end identity authentication unit configured to determine whether data received by the front-end is legitimate.
  3. 3. The system of claim 2, wherein the front-end data receiving module further comprises a front-end data screening unit for screening whether the front-end received data is system service subscription data or desired data.
  4. 4. The system of claim 3, wherein the front-end data receiving module further comprises a front-end format detecting unit for detecting whether a data format received by the front-end is a standard format.
  5. 5. The system of claim 1, wherein the background data receiving module includes a background identity authentication unit for determining whether data received in the background is legitimate.
  6. 6. The system of claim 5, wherein the background data receiving module further comprises a background data screening unit for screening whether the data received in the background is system service subscription data or desired data.
  7. 7. The system of claim 6, wherein the background data receiving module further comprises a background system format detecting unit, the background system format detecting unit configured to detect whether a data format received in the background is a standard format.
  8. 8. The system of any of claims 1-7, further comprising a real-time display module for displaying the latest data in real-time according to preset display rules.
  9. 9. A method for implementing data bidirectional communication by a digital twin multi-path read-write device, comprising: The front-end data receiving module receives the data of the diversity equipment and the data sent by the background data distributing module, and performs identity authentication, screening and noise filtering data and format judgment on the data received by the front end; the front-end data unified processing module performs unified conversion on data which is not in a standard format in the data received by the front end, converts the data into the data in the standard format, and sends the data in the standard format to the front-end message event interaction module; The front-end message event interaction module is used for receiving data in a standard format, updating a message event, informing a corresponding module to process the message event, judging whether the message event meets the trigger event condition to obtain a judging result, and executing corresponding operation according to the judging result; the front-end data distribution module sends out the data of which the front end meets the triggering event; The background data receiving module receives the data of the diversity equipment and the data sent by the front-end data distribution module, and performs identity authentication, screening and noise filtering data and format judgment on the data received by the background; the background data unified processing module performs unified conversion on data which is not in a standard format in the data received by the background, converts the data into the data in the standard format, and sends the data in the standard format to the background message event interaction module; The background message event interaction module receives data in a standard format, updates a message event, informs a corresponding module to process the message event, judges whether the message event meets a trigger event condition to obtain a judgment result, and executes corresponding operation according to the judgment result; The background data distribution module sends out data of which the background meets the triggering event condition; The front-end data receiving module and the background data receiving module simultaneously receive processing data sent by the diversity equipment, the front-end module and the background module can process the processing data directly, the data which cannot be processed is processed by other recognition modules and then distributed, the diversity equipment data can be directly communicated with the front-end visualization, and the diversity equipment data is changed into internal data after being processed by the background data and then distributed to other back-end modules or the front-end module.
  10. 10. The method of claim 9, wherein the front-end data receiving module performs identity authentication, screening and noise data filtering and format judgment on the front-end received data, and specifically comprises judging whether the front-end received data is legal or not; screening whether the data received by the front end is subscription data or required data of the system service; detecting whether a data format received by the front end is a standard format or not; The background data receiving module performs identity authentication, discrimination and noise filtering data and format judgment on the data received by the background, and specifically comprises the following steps: Judging whether the data received by the background are legal or not; Screening whether the data received by the background is subscription data or required data of the system service; and detecting whether the data format received by the background is a standard format.

Description

System and method for realizing bidirectional communication of digital twin multi-path read-write equipment data Technical Field The invention relates to the technical field of information of the Internet of things, in particular to a system and a method for realizing bidirectional communication of digital twin multi-path read-write equipment data. Background With the continuous development of 5G, internet of things and information technology, the corresponding intelligent life demand scale is increased in geometric progression, wherein the intelligent life demand scale comprises digital twinning, web SCADA and other digital visualization, intelligent and other scenes. Small-sized mobile phones, household appliances, automobiles, machinery, large-sized parks, traffic, logistics, cities and the like, and the intelligent sensing, intelligent identification, information communication and other digitization and intellectualization are realized by utilizing the internet of things technology. The number of electronic devices, machines and other infrastructures which have moved into our living aspects is increasing, and the interaction requirements of a large number of diverse infrastructure devices for accessing a digital twin system and fast real-time two-way communication on visualization are increasing. Due to the huge amount of infrastructure, the great variety and the staggered complexity of the acquired space sites, the diversity of data transmission protocols and the diversity of data formats are caused, the contradiction between the docking and maintenance of various different data and operation and maintenance costs is increasingly prominent, and the requirements for large amount of data communication and rapid data response are also higher and higher. The seamless fusion of various different types of equipment data and different protocol equipment data allows people to concentrate on the convenience and intelligence of digital twinning and visualization without having to pay attention to the urgent increase of various different equipment and data of the bottom layer. Disclosure of Invention Aiming at the defects in the prior art, the system and the method for realizing the bidirectional communication of the digital twin multi-path read-write equipment data can quickly, simply and effectively solve the problem of the data communication of the diversity of the digital twin equipment, realize the real-time data response of the digital twin system and have better expandability and maintainability. In a first aspect, the system for realizing bidirectional communication of digital twin multi-path read-write equipment data provided by the embodiment of the invention comprises a front-end data receiving module, a front-end data unified processing module, a front-end message event interaction module, a front-end data distribution module, a background data receiving module, a background data unified processing module, a background message event interaction module and a background data distribution module, wherein, The front-end data receiving module is used for receiving the data of the diversified devices and the data sent by the background data distribution module, and carrying out identity authentication, screening and noise filtering data and format judgment on the data received by the front end; The front-end data unified processing module is used for carrying out unified conversion on data formats which are not in the standard format in the data received by the front end, converting the data into the data in the standard format and sending the data in the standard format to the front-end message event interaction module; the front-end message event interaction module is used for receiving data in a standard format, updating a message event, informing a corresponding module to process the message event, judging whether the message event meets the trigger event condition to obtain a judging result, and executing corresponding operation according to the judging result; the front-end data distribution module sends out the data of which the front end meets the triggering event; the background data receiving module is used for receiving the data of the diversified devices and the data sent by the front-end data distribution module, and carrying out identity authentication, screening and noise filtering data and format judgment on the data received by the background; the background data unified processing module is used for carrying out unified conversion on data which is not in a standard format in the data received by the background, converting the data into the data in the standard format and sending the data in the standard format to the background message event interaction module; The background message event interaction module is used for receiving data in a standard format, updating a message event, informing a corresponding module to process the message event, judging whether the message event meets the tr